Located just outside Stockholm in Grant County, this rural property includes approximately 74.53 acres featuring a renovated home, multiple agricultural outbuildings, pasture ground, and infrastructure suited for livestock operations. The property offers space for farming, livestock management, recreation, and rural living within northeastern South Dakota. At the center of the property is a five-bedroom, three-bathroom home that has been thoughtfully updated in recent years. The main floor underwent a significant renovation in 2016, improving the layout and functionality of the living spaces while maintaining the character expected of a rural residence. The home provides ample living space with multiple bedrooms and bathrooms, allowing flexibility for family living, guest accommodations, or home office use. The updates completed in 2016 modernized the kitchen, living areas, and other key spaces to support comfortable day-to-day living in a rural setting. The basement of the home includes improvements that are supported by a lifetime warranty from Blackburn Basement Systems. This warranty documents work that was completed to address the basement structure and moisture management. Improvements of this type can help maintain the condition of the home's lower level and provide additional peace of mind for future owners. Water infrastructure on the property includes both rural water service and an artesian well. Rural water provides a reliable source of potable water to the residence and farmstead, while the artesian well offers an additional water source that may be utilized for livestock or other agricultural purposes, depending on management preferences. The farmstead includes multiple outbuildings that support agricultural use. The main barn features a recently installed roof that carries a 20-year transferable warranty. This recent upgrade helps reduce near term maintenance considerations and supports continued use of the structure for livestock, storage, or agricultural operations. The barns on the property are equipped with three-phase electrical service. Three-phase power allows for the efficient operation of agricultural equipment, ventilation systems, feeding equipment, and other infrastructure commonly used in livestock facilities. Access to this level of electrical service can be valuable for producers who operate or plan to expand agricultural operations. The property holds a Class E Concentrated Animal Feeding Operation permit that allows for up to 298 animals. This permit provides flexibility for livestock production within the framework of state and local regulations. Prospective buyers should review permit details and confirm compliance requirements with the appropriate agencies. Beyond the farmstead, the approximately 90 acres include pasture and open ground suitable for livestock grazing or horses. The acreage provides room for rotational grazing, hay production, or other agricultural uses, depending on the goals of the owner. The open space also creates opportunities for outdoor recreation, such as hunting and wildlife observation. Grant County and the surrounding region feature a landscape of cropland, pasture, wetlands, and shelterbelts that support diverse wildlife habitat. Deer, upland birds, and other wildlife species are common throughout the area, offering opportunities for recreational use of the land. The property benefits from its proximity to nearby communities while maintaining a quiet rural setting. Stockholm is located a short distance away and offers a small-town environment. Larger service communities are also within a convenient drive. The property is located approximately 15 miles from Milbank, about 30 miles from Watertown, and roughly 130 miles from Sioux Falls. These communities provide access to healthcare, agricultural services, retail, and transportation corridors.
